enum LNBC_STATE {
LNBC_STATE_UNKNOWN, /* Unknown */
LNBC_STATE_SLEEP, /* Sleep */
LNBC_STATE_ACTIVE /* Active */
};
enum LNBC_VOLTAGE {
LNBC_VOLTAGE_OFF, /* OFF output voltage. */
LNBC_VOLTAGE_LOW, /* Low voltage. */
LNBC_VOLTAGE_HIGH, /* High voltage. */
LNBC_VOLTAGE_AUTO, /* Control by demodulator. (For single cable, using TXEN) */
};
enum LNBC_TONE {
LNBC_TONE_OFF, /* Not output tone signal. */
LNBC_TONE_ON, /* Output tone signal. */
LNBC_TONE_AUTO, /* Control tone by demodulator. (Default) */
};
enum LNBC_TRANSMIT_MODE {
LNBC_TRANSMIT_MODE_TX, /* TX mode. */
LNBC_TRANSMIT_MODE_RX, /* RX mode. */
LNBC_TRANSMIT_MODE_AUTO, /* Control by demodulator. (For receiving DiSEqC2.x reply) */
};
enum LNBC_CONFIG_ID {
LNBC_CONFIG_ID_TONE_INTERNAL, /* Tone mode (0: External tone, 1: Internal tone). */
LNBC_CONFIG_ID_LOW_VOLTAGE, /* Definition of voltage for "Low voltage". */
LNBC_CONFIG_ID_HIGH_VOLTAGE /* Definition of voltage for "High voltage". */
};
/*
* LNB controller diagnostic status bit definitions used for get status return value.
*/
#define LNBC_DIAG_STATUS_THERMALSHUTDOWN 0x00000001 /* Thermal shutdown triggered. */
#define LNBC_DIAG_STATUS_OVERCURRENT 0x00000002 /* Over current protection triggered. */
#define LNBC_DIAG_STATUS_CABLEOPEN 0x00000004 /* Cable is not connected. */
#define LNBC_DIAG_STATUS_VOUTOUTOFRANGE 0x00000008 /* Output voltage is out of range. */
#define LNBC_DIAG_STATUS_VINOUTOFRANGE 0x00000010 /* Input voltage is out of range. */
#define LNBC_DIAG_STATUS_BACKBIAS 0x00000020 /* Back bias is detected. */
#define LNBC_DIAG_STATUS_LNBCDISABLE 0x00010000 /* LNB controller is now disabled. */
